The 2024 "Alchemy" exhibition at Riche's Art Gallery was curated to represent growth and emphasize "The Arts" and the ability to heal through artistic expression. This year's exhibit highlights growth and expansion as a major theme .

My abstract piece " 90's Mix Tape" made its debut as part of the "Alchemy" exhibit from April 5- May 26, 2024 at Rich's Art Gallery 2511 E 6th st. Austin, Tx and Sold at the Williamson County Art Guild Gallery on Dec 6 2024.

Peacocks symbolize beauty, power, rank/ royalty, divinity, and good luck, also said to increase awareness and protection. They also represent fame! Who knew ?!

Before she got a sassy makeover in 2024 with the graffiti and bling, this pompous peacock actually made a feature in a local Austin indie art and fashion magazine called "Bevie" back in 2017 .
measurements 27x 27

This sassy peacock screaming "no bad vibes" exhibits from Jun 27- July 31 at 610 S Main St, Georgetown, TX 78626 As part of the "cool" exhibit themed around anything hip or slang .

Three signature pieces made their debut at The Hive- Bee Cave Arts Foundation for the 15th anniversary reception "Elevator Music" "The Invitation" and "Wanderland"

All showed at the beautiful HillCountry Galleria from August - September 2025 in collaboration with the Creative Arts Society.
